Can I import my Mailchimp contacts to another platform?
Yes, all major email platforms accept CSV imports from Mailchimp. Export your contacts from Mailchimp as a CSV file, then import into your new platform. Most tools complete the import within minutes for lists under 50,000 contacts. However, you will need to manually map custom fields and segments — the platform cannot automatically detect which Mailchimp fields map to which fields in your new tool. Will I lose my email designs when switching from Mailchimp?
Your HTML code and images remain yours, but design portability depends on your new platform's template system. Mailchimp's template system uses proprietary merge tags and conditional logic that may not translate directly. Most alternatives (Klaviyo, ConvertKit, MailerLite) accept custom HTML, so you can paste your Mailchimp template code directly. However, you will lose access to Mailchimp's drag-and-drop editor unless your new platform has a compatible builder. Which alternative is best for fashion ecommerce: Klaviyo or Omnisend?
Klaviyo excels for Shopify stores over $100K annual revenue because it offers native product data sync, revenue attribution, and predictive analytics. You see exactly which email drove which sale. Omnisend is better for smaller Shopify stores ($20K-$100K) because it bundles SMS and email in one platform at lower cost. Klaviyo pricing starts at $20/month for under 500 contacts but scales with contact count; Omnisend charges $16-$99/month depending on contact tier.
